|
|
|||||||||||||||||||||
PREV PACKAGE NEXT PACKAGE | FRAMES NO FRAMES |
See:
Description
Interface Summary | |
---|---|
ExceptionMessages | Interface to collect exception messages that are used in several cases. |
Identifiable | Defines the requirements for objects that are identifiable, i.e. objects which have an unique id. |
IterableIterator<T> | Interface that is both Iterable and an Iterator. |
Class Summary | |
---|---|
AnyMap<K> | Associative storage based on a HashMap for multiple object types that
offers a type checked AnyMap.get(Object, Class) method. |
ByteArrayUtil | Class with various utilities for manipulating byte arrays. |
ClassGenericsUtil | Utils for handling class instantiation especially with respect to Java generics. |
ConstantObject<D extends ConstantObject<D>> | ConstantObject provides a parent class for constant objects, that are immutable and unique by class and name. |
DatabaseUtil | Class with Database-related utility functions such as centroid computation, covariances etc. |
FileUtil | Various static helper methods to deal with files and file names. |
FormatUtil | Utility methods for output formatting of various number objects |
HandlerList<H> | Manages a list of handlers for objects. |
HashMapList<K,V> | Multi-Associative container, that stores a list of values for a particular key. |
HyperBoundingBox | HyperBoundingBox represents a hyperrectangle in the multidimensional space. |
InspectionUtil | A collection of inspection-related utility functions. |
InspectionUtil.ClassSorter | Sort classes by their class name. |
InspectionUtil.DirClassIterator | Class to iterate over a directory tree. |
InspectionUtil.JarClassIterator | Class to iterate over a Jar file. |
IterableIteratorAdapter<T> | This interface can convert an Iterable to an Iterator or the
other way round. |
ModifiableHyperBoundingBox | MBR class allowing modifications (as opposed to HyperBoundingBox ). |
QueryStatistic | Provides some statistics about queries using a filter-refinement architecture. |
Util | This class collects various static helper methods. |
Util.MaskedArrayList<T> | This class is a virtual collection based on masking an array list using a bit mask. |
Exception Summary | |
---|---|
UnableToComplyException | General Exception to state inability to execute an operation. |
Utility and helper classes - commonly used data structures, output formatting, exceptions, ...
Specialized utility classes (which often collect static utility methods only) can be found in other places of ELKI as well, as seen below.
Important utility function collections:
Util
: Miscellaneous utility functions.OptionUtil
: Managing parameter settingsDatabaseUtil
: database utility functions (centroid etc.).MathUtil
: Mathematics utility functions.DistanceUtil
: distance functions related (min, max for Distance
s).ResultUtil
: result processing functions (e.g. extracting sub-results).ClassGenericsUtil
: Generic classes (instantiation, arrays of arrays, sets that require safe but unchecked casts).LoggingUtil
: simple logging. FormatUtil
: output formatting.HTMLUtil
: HTML (with XML DOM) generation.SVGUtil
: SVG generation (XML DOM based).ByteArrayUtil
: byte array processing (low-level IO via byte arrays)FileUtil
: File and file name utility functions.
|
|
|||||||||||
PREV PACKAGE NEXT PACKAGE | FRAMES NO FRAMES |